Envelhecimento renal

Abstract

Com o envelhecimento renal, ocorrem alterações morfológicas e funcionais que predispõem o rim a patologia, ou acentuam patologia previamente existente. Os mecanismos de senescência celular, subjacentes a algumas das alterações anatómicas e funcionais associadas ao envelhecimento do rim, têm-se tornado mais claros, permitindo uma melhor compreensão deste processo e o desenvolvimento de novas terapias, que permitam minimizar o dano renal e promover a longevidade. Com este artigo pretendo rever os aspectos anatómicos, funcionais e os mecanismos de senescência celular associados ao envelhecimento renal.

With aging, renal morphologic and functional changes that occur predispose to kidney pathology, or exacerbate pre-existing pathology. The mechanisms of cellular senescence, some of the underlying anatomical and functional changes associated with aging of the kidney, have become clearer, allowing a better understanding of this process and the development of new therapies that minimize renal damage and promote longevity. With this article I intend to review the anatomical and functional features and mechanisms of cellular senescence associated with aging kidney.
